Look Up

Today I was mowing the lawn and kept seeing this huge shadow sweep across the grass.

Every time it happened, I’d look up expecting to see a hawk or an eagle.

Instead, it was a tiny finch.

It made me wonder how often we do the same thing with our lives.

Sometimes the thing casting the biggest shadow over us isn’t actually as big as it feels.

Maybe it’s an old comment.

Maybe it’s a childhood belief.

Maybe it’s a mistake we made years ago.

The shadow grows larger than the thing itself.

And before we know it, we’ve spent years organizing our lives around a bird that was never as big as we imagined.

Healing isn’t pretending the bird doesn’t exist.

It’s looking up.
